NARA: Network Assisted Routing and Allocation Algorithm for D2D Communication in 5G Cellular Networks
This work presents the Network Assisted Routing and Allocation Algorithm (NARA), a routing and allocation algorithm for device-to-device (D2D) communication in 5G cellular architectures.
